[GPU PLM] Moving an Object while baking breaks directionality
Steps to reproduce:
1. Open the updated CornellBox project
2. Open the Test Runner Window (Window > General > Test Runner)
3. Click Run All
4. Observe the Scene View
Reproduces in: 2019.1.0a14, 2019.1.0b1, 2019.3.0a3, 2019.3.0a10, 2019.3.0b8, 2019.3.0f5, 2019.3.7f1, 2020.1.0b1, 2020.2.0a4, 2020.2.0a5, 2020.2.0a6
Could not reproduce with: 2019.1.0a10, 2019.1.0a5, 2019.1.0a1, 2018.2.21f1
Could not repro on 2020.2.0a12 because of a bake looping bug currently under investigation.
Note: This only reproduces with the GPU Lightmapper, and with Progressive Updates ON.
If you're trying to repro the bug and iterate fast, it is recommended to use the lowest possible sample counts, GPU PLM and no filtering.
